What Is Martin Luther King Day?

Martin Luther King Day (MLK day) is a federal holiday that is celebrated every year on the third Monday of January. It commemorates the birthday of Martin Luther King, who was an American civil rights leader and preacher.

He is best remembered for the “I Have A Dream” speech he gave in front of the Lincoln Memorial during a march on Washington (with which he persuaded America to end segregation).

This holiday is a great opportunity to honor Martin Luther King and the sacrifices he made for our rights as Americans, but it’s even more than that. It’s an opportunity to think about how we can better ourselves as individuals and as a nation.
